About

A fragrant plant extract or essential oil used mostly for scent, with the usual risk of irritation seen with terpene-rich botanicals.

Botanical fragrance extracts are complex mixtures of terpenes and other aromatic compounds rather than a single well-defined molecule. They are often tolerated at low use levels, but oxidized fragrance components can irritate skin or trigger allergy in sensitive users.
